Tail Talk

A cat's tail conveys emotions.  High = confident, low = scared. Pay attention to the movement of the tail to read their mood.

Ears Tell All

Pointy ears signify curiosity,  while flattened ears signal fear. Watch for subtle changes in ear position.

Eyes Speak 

Slow blinking is a sign of trust, while dilated pupils indicates excitement or fear.  Eyes reveal a cat's inner world.

Body Posture

Arched back and raised fur indicate aggression or fear, while a relaxed posture with a slightly curled tail signals contentment.

Vocalization

Cats use vocal cues to express their needs and emotions. Meows show hunger or distress, purring signifies contentment or comfort.
